Pro Designed for education
A primary goal of Pyret is to be an excellent choice for a first programming language. This heavily influences the development of the language. For example: if it's felt that some aspect of the language could be made better for the language's users, The development team won't hesitate about implementing breaking (non backwards compatible) changes into Pyret for the greater good of the language. This makes Pyret an impressively "wart free" programming language.